From: Mimiviridae: clusters of orthologous genes, reconstruction of gene repertoire evolution and proposed expansion of the giant virus family

Figure 1

Phyletic distribution of Refseq best BLAST hits of P. globosa virus 12 T (PGV), Organic Lake phycodnavirus 1 (OLPV1), and Organic Lake phycodnavirus 2 (OLPV2). The family Mimiviridae included C. roenbergensis virus BV-PW1, A. polyphaga mimivirus, and Megavirus chiliensis. Phycodnaviridae include: Bathycoccus sp. RCC1105 virus BpV1, Ectocarpus siliculosus virus 1, Emiliania huxleyi virus 86, Feldmannia species virus, Micromonas sp. RCC1109 virus MpV1, Ostreococcus lucimarinus virus OlV1, O. tauri virus 1, O. tauri virus 2, O. tauri virus OsV5, and Chloroviruses.
